WoRMS taxon details
Megayoldia thraciaeformis (Storer, 1838)
141983 (urn:lsid:marinespecies.org:taxname:141983)
accepted
Species
Leda thraciaeformis (Storer, 1838) · unaccepted > junior subjective synonym
Microyoldia ochotensis Scarlato, 1981 · unaccepted > junior subjective synonym
Microyoldia regularis (A. E. Verrill, 1884) · unaccepted > junior subjective synonym
Nucula groenlandica Posselt, 1898 · unaccepted
Nucula laternaria Valenciennes, 1846 · unaccepted
Nucula navicularis Couthouy, 1839 · unaccepted
Nucula thraciaeformis Storer, 1838 · unaccepted (original combination)
Portlandia (Megayoldia) thraciaeformis (Storer, 1838) · unaccepted > junior subjective synonym
Portlandia dalli A. Krause, 1885 · unaccepted
Yoldia (Megayoldia) thraciaeformis (Storer, 1838) · unaccepted > superseded combination
Yoldia angularis Møller, 1842 · unaccepted
Yoldia mulleri J. E. Gray, 1847 · unaccepted
Yoldia regularis A. E. Verrill, 1884 · unaccepted > junior subjective synonym
Yoldia scapha Yokoyama, 1926 † · unaccepted
Yoldia secunda Dall, 1916 · unaccepted > junior subjective synonym
Yoldia thraciaeformis (Storer, 1838) · unaccepted > junior subjective synonym
